What you\’ll do
In this role, you\’ll support day-to-day accounting operations and month-end close activities across multiple entities. You\’ll work closely with the wider finance team to ensure financial information is accurate, compliant, and delivered on time.
- Assist with Management Accounts month-end close processes
- Prepare and post journals, including accruals, prepayments, and intercompany entries
- Maintain and reconcile balance sheet accounts, investigating and resolving discrepancies
- Support audit and statutory reporting activities by preparing schedules and responding to queries
- Process intercompany transactions and assist with group reporting and consolidations
- Help prepare trial balances and contribute to management and financial reporting
- Follow internal controls, policies, and accounting procedures
- Support documentation, process improvements, and efficiency initiatives
- Collaborate with colleagues across finance and other departments to resolve queries and share information
